Girl Talk: Discovering Identity in a Safe Space for Teenage Girls
Description
Adolescence is a time of transition, where peer influence begins to shape identity and self-worth. In this episode, therapist Heather Caballero explores the power of group therapy in providing teenage girls with a safe space to express themselves, navigate societal pressures, and build confidence. Listen to Heather discuss the pressing issues faced by teenagers, including body image, academic pressures, and family dynamics and the importance of open dialogue and support.
